Obviously.AI is a no-code platform that empowers users to build and deploy machine learning models quickly without any coding expertise. The platform focuses on predictive analytics, allowing businesses to make data-driven decisions by predicting outcomes such as customer behavior, sales trends, and other business metrics. Users can upload their datasets, and the platform’s AI automatically generates predictive models, providing actionable insights in minutes.
Features of Obviously.AI
- No-Code Model Building: Create and deploy machine learning models without coding or data science expertise.
- Automated Predictions: Generate accurate predictions based on historical data, such as sales forecasts, customer churn, and more.
- Data Upload and Integration: Easily upload datasets or integrate with existing data sources to start building models immediately.
- Explainable AI: Understand the reasoning behind the AI’s predictions with detailed explanations and insights.
- Real-Time Analytics: Get real-time predictive analytics to inform business decisions quickly and effectively.
